Transaction 77f66bdff3e7a828e07c20965a113c6290db974a3207e7c0513b9030b8a43388
1 Input
1 Output
-
77f66bdff3e7a828e07c20965a113c6290db974a3207e7c0513b9030b8a43388:0
- value
- 95639
- script pubkey
- OP_0 OP_PUSHBYTES_20 1eb8e1695311649f97abb1bc2a96c0064b3080d2
- address
- bc1qr6uwz62nz9jfl9atkx7z49kqqe9npqxjr0mur3